我的表使用筹码输入“类型”下的值。但是当其中没有值时。里面还有一块空筹码。有谁知道我该如何解决这个问题?
[![html
<ng-container matColumnDef="type">
<th mat-header-cell *matHeaderCellDef mat-sort-header="type">Type</th>
<td mat-cell *matCellDef="let truck" class="pr-24">
<mat-chip-list>
<span *ngFor="let truck of truck.type.split(',')">
<mat-chip>{{truck}}</mat-chip>
</span>
</mat-chip-list>
</td>
</ng-container>][1]][1]
component.ts
import { Component, OnInit, ViewChild, ElementRef, Input, OnChanges } from '@angular/core';
import { MatPaginator, MatSort, MatTableDataSource, MatDialog, MatChipsModule, MatChipInputEvent } from '@angular/material';
import { SelectionModel } from '@angular/cdk/collections';
import { Truck } from '../truck';
import { MapsAPILoader } from '@agm/core';
import { TruckDetailComponent } from '../truck-detail/truck-detail.component';
import { PlannerProject } from 'app/services/planner-projects/planner-project';
import { TrucksService } from '../trucks.service';
import { map, debounceTime, distinctUntilChanged, tap } from 'rxjs/operators';
import * as _ from 'lodash';
import { fromEvent } from 'rxjs';
import { ConfirmComponent } from 'app/shared/components/confirm/confirm.component';
import { FuseConfirmDialogComponent } from '@fuse/components/confirm-dialog/confirm-dialog.component';
import { MyDialogComponent } from 'app/main/delivery-orders/my-dialog/my-dialog.component';
import {COMMA, ENTER} from '@angular/cdk/keycodes';
@Component({
selector: 'app-trucks',
templateUrl: './trucks.component.html',
styleUrls: ['./trucks.component.scss']
})
export class TrucksComponent implements OnInit, OnChanges {
@Input() project: PlannerProject;
@ViewChild(MatPaginator) paginator: MatPaginator;
@ViewChild(MatSort) sort: MatSort;
selection: SelectionModel<Truck>;
因此,如果没有数据,它应该在没有芯片的行中显示一个空白区域
宝慕林4294392
慕尼黑的夜晚无繁华
慕仙森
相关分类